Janani Luwum was a prominent Ugandan Anglican Archbishop known for his courageous stand against the oppressive regime of Idi Amin in the 1970s. His unwavering commitment to justice and human rights made him a martyr in the eyes of many, as he was ultimately killed for his outspoken opposition to the government's brutality.
